On the Honda CRF250X, you have a range that the TPS must be within, and outside that range indicates the TPS is not working and must be replaced. Where as low rpm+ low throttle setting= is low cylinder fill (low compression rise) which can tolerate more advance. Probably not, if everything else checks out, you may just be seeing the effect of the manufacturing tolerances of the TPS and the throttle body stacking up and pushing the setting outside the "normal" range. The air screw is a small (5mm in diameter) slotted brass adjustment screw located on the inlet side (air filter side) of the carburetor. air.
